Faisal Islamic Bank of Egypt provides retail and corporate banking, and investment services in Egypt and internationally.The company operates through Large, Medium, and Small Enterprises; Investment; Individuals; and Other Activities segments.It offers current and debit current accounts; deposits; finance and investment transactions; financial derivatives; saving pools; and personal and real estate Murabaha.The company also engages in mergers, purchase of investments; and restructuring financing companies and instruments; as well as other banking activities, such as fund management.In addition, it provides mutual funds and saving certificates; Faisal, investment, Bab Rizk, joint, and investment accounts for minors; bank cards; e-wallet; and digital and online banking services, as well as letters of credit and guarantee.Further, the company offers promotion and marketing, real-estate marketing, specialized exhibitions, appraisal, and other services, such as payment of periodical commitments and regular dues, and concluding sale and rent contracts and real-estate mortgage agreements.Faisal Islamic Bank of Egypt was founded in 1977 and is headquartered in Cairo, Egypt.
